Running a RING wheel strategy lets you generate consistent premium income on iShares MSCI Global Gold Miners ETF while setting your own entry and exit prices on the underlying. iShares MSCI Global Gold Miners ETF's wheel combines cash-secured puts and covered calls into a repeatable cycle: sell puts at strikes where you'd be happy to own RING, and if assigned, sell calls at strikes where you'd be happy to sell. The wheel works best on liquid, high-quality names with stable fundamentals and active options markets — exactly the profile many large-cap leaders fit. The mechanics are simple: sell a cash-secured put on RING, collect premium, and either keep the premium if it expires worthless or take assignment at a discount to current price. Once assigned, sell covered calls against the shares to keep collecting premium until they're called away. Choosing the right strikes, expirations, and IV environment is what separates a profitable RING wheel from a losing one.
The iShares MSCI Global Gold Miners ETF seeks to track the investment results of an index composed of global equities of companies primarily engaged in the business of gold mining.
